Angry not happy!!!!!!

Ive been going trough a relapse for like a month.

Last week,i started to feel like my legs were jello,and i am haveing bladder problems..

I have severe weakness,so bad that I got stuck in the bathtub,
I went to the ER on sunday morning,and the ER doctor said I was in a flare,and did a solumedrol push,to lession the sx.
At this point I had severe pain in my feet,so the solumedrol took the pain away,till today that is.

I went to my neuro today,and she said it wasnt urgent enough for solumedrol...

warning!!Excuse my laungage..

Ok I went in to the office,bearly made it to her office.

I was in there,with my bags packed,and ready to be put in the hospital.

She asked a bunch of questions,one was bout my bladder,which I cant seem to pee..
I told her this,and she wrote it down,the moved on to the neuro exam..

She did the lil push ,pull thing,I got confused,and then she got rude with me over it..

I was ******,but thats not all.

She made me do the drunk walk,which I about fell,and I was turning to the right.

the she said,it isnt urgent enough for solumedrol,and ordered a MRI..
That was it, She refused to put me on anything,I told her Ive had severe pain in my feet,and she ignored me.

I was so ****** at this point,that I was seeing red!!.

I knew there was a reason i was wanting to fire her in the frist place.

So tomorrow im gonna look up neuro's in the tulsa area,and hope that one of them will work me like soon..
